Here is an inspiring story, based on Ron McNair’s life, of how a little boy, future scientist, and Challenger astronaut desegregated his … Ron's Big Mission is a fictional account of a real incident in the life of Ron McNair that was recounted by his mother and others in his town.Ron McNair was an African-American astronaut who lost his life when the Challenger space shuttle exploded in 1986.But long before he was an astronaut hero, he was an ordinary hero in a big way in his small South Carolina town.
